The Four LED States

The Four LED States — What Each One Means and What It Requires in Keedysville, MD

State One — Both LEDs Solid — Sensor System Not the Cause in Keedysville

Both sensor LEDs solid indicates the transmitter is producing the infrared beam and the receiver is correctly detecting it in Keedysville, MD. The sensor system is functioning correctly in Keedysville. If the door still won't close with both LEDs solid, the sensor system is not the cause of the won't-close symptom in Keedysville, MD. EZ Open moves to the next step in the won't-close diagnostic hierarchy in Keedysville. Down-travel limit setting assessment. Physical obstruction check. Spring balance and force limit assessment in Keedysville, MD.

State Two — Receiver LED Blinking, Transmitter LED Solid — Misalignment or Obstruction in Keedysville, MD

The transmitter is producing the beam, its LED is solid, in Keedysville. The receiver isn't correctly detecting the full beam, its LED is blinking, in Keedysville, MD. This state indicates one of three possible causes in Keedysville. The receiver sensor bracket has rotated out of correct alignment and the beam isn't hitting the receiver lens. A physical obstruction between the two sensors is blocking the beam in Keedysville, MD. Or sunlight is hitting the receiver lens at an angle that overwhelms the receiver's ability to detect the transmitter's beam against the solar background in Keedysville.

State Three — Receiver LED Off, Transmitter LED Solid — Wiring or Power Fault at Receiver in Keedysville

The transmitter has power, its LED is solid, in Keedysville, MD. The receiver has no power, its LED is completely off, in Keedysville. A completely off LED indicates no power reaching the sensor unit in Keedysville, MD. The most common cause is a break in the wiring between the receiver sensor and the opener control board in Keedysville. The break may be from a staple driven through the wire during installation, a rodent chew, a physical disturbance that kinked or cut the wire, or a loose connection at the control board terminal in Keedysville, MD.

State Four — Both LEDs Off — No Power to Either Sensor in Keedysville, MD

Both LEDs off indicates no power reaching either sensor in Keedysville. The most common cause is a loose or disconnected connection at the sensor terminal on the opener control board where both sensor wires connect in Keedysville, MD. Both sensors share the same power supply from the opener in Keedysville. If the connection that supplies power to both sensors is loose or disconnected, both sensors lose power simultaneously in Keedysville, MD.

The Bracket Adjustment Test

The Bracket Adjustment Test — How EZ Open Distinguishes Misalignment From Failure in Keedysville, MD

What the Bracket Adjustment Test Involves in Keedysville

The bracket adjustment test is performed when the receiver LED is blinking and no physical obstruction is visible between the two sensors in Keedysville, MD. The receiver sensor bracket is gently adjusted through its complete range of angular positions while the receiver LED is continuously observed in Keedysville. The bracket is moved through every angle at which the receiver lens could potentially receive the transmitter's beam in Keedysville, MD. The test takes approximately sixty to ninety seconds to complete through the full bracket range in Keedysville.

What a Positive Result Tells Us — The Sensor Is Functional in Keedysville, MD

If the receiver LED becomes solid at any point during the bracket adjustment, at any angle within the bracket's range of motion, the sensor's internal photoelectric component is functional in Keedysville. The sensor is correctly detecting the transmitter's beam when the beam is correctly aligned with the receiver lens in Keedysville, MD. The cause of the blinking LED was misalignment of the bracket rather than failure of the sensor component in Keedysville. The bracket is locked in the position where the LED became solid in Keedysville, MD. No sensor replacement is needed in Keedysville.

What a Negative Result Tells Us — The Sensor Has Failed in Keedysville, MD

If the receiver LED stays blinking through the complete range of bracket adjustment with no physical obstruction between the sensors in Keedysville, the sensor's internal photoelectric component has failed in Keedysville, MD. The component isn't detecting the transmitter's beam at any angle because it can no longer detect infrared radiation at the transmitter's frequency in Keedysville. The sensor requires replacement in Keedysville, MD. EZ Open carries compatible replacement sensors for all major opener brands in Keedysville.

Sensor Bracket Misalignment From Physical Contact or Vibration in Keedysville

The sensor bracket is designed to be adjustable for installation in Keedysville, MD. That adjustability also means the bracket can rotate out of correct alignment from physical contact with a person, object, or vehicle that bumps the sensor or the bracket during garage use in Keedysville. Door operation vibration over years of cycling can also slowly rotate the bracket away from its correct angle in Keedysville, MD. The bracket adjustment test confirms misalignment as the cause in Keedysville. Bracket adjustment and locking in the correct position resolves the fault in Keedysville, MD.

Physical Obstruction Between the Sensors in Keedysville

An object positioned in the path between the two sensors at floor level blocks the infrared beam and produces the same blinking receiver LED as misalignment in Keedysville, MD. A tool, a piece of equipment, a floor mat shifted into the path, or debris accumulation at the door threshold in Keedysville. Removing the obstruction restores correct beam transmission in Keedysville, MD.

Solar Interference — The Time-of-Day Fault in Keedysville, MD

Direct sunlight entering the garage can contain sufficient infrared radiation to overwhelm the receiver's ability to detect the transmitter's specific beam against the solar background in Keedysville. The symptom occurs only when the sun is at a specific angle that directs sunlight onto the receiver lens in Keedysville, MD. The time-of-day pattern is the identifying characteristic in Keedysville. A door that won't close in the afternoon but closes correctly in the morning and evening is almost certainly experiencing solar interference in Keedysville, MD.

Wiring Fault Between Sensor and Opener Control Board in Keedysville

The low-voltage wiring connecting each sensor to the opener control board runs from the sensor bracket up the door frame and along the ceiling to the opener unit in Keedysville, MD. Any break, short circuit, or poor connection along this run produces sensor LED behavior that appears identical to sensor misalignment or failure in Keedysville. EZ Open inspects the complete wiring run where an off LED or persistent blinking LED doesn't respond to bracket adjustment in Keedysville, MD.

Sensor Component Failure — When Replacement Is Actually Required in Keedysville, MD

A sensor with a failed internal photoelectric component requires replacement in Keedysville. The component failure is confirmed by the negative result of the bracket adjustment test, the receiver LED stays blinking through the complete bracket range with no obstruction between the sensors in Keedysville, MD. Replacement with a compatible sensor for the specific opener brand restores correct function in Keedysville.

Opener Control Board Fault Producing Sensor-Like Symptoms in Keedysville, MD

In specific cases, a fault in the opener control board itself produces symptoms that appear identical to a sensor fault in Keedysville. The board may incorrectly interpret the sensor signal as a beam interruption when the sensor is correctly functioning in Keedysville, MD. EZ Open identifies control board involvement through elimination of all sensor-level causes in Keedysville.

Why Bypassing the Sensor Is Never the Correct Response

Why Bypassing the Sensor Is Never the Correct Response in Keedysville, MD

What the 1992 Federal Mandate Was Responding To in Keedysville

The Consumer Product Safety Commission's 1992 mandate requiring entrapment protection on all residential garage door openers was issued in response to a documented pattern of children being struck and in some cases fatally injured by closing garage doors in Keedysville, MD. The automatic reversal provided by the sensor system was specifically designed to address the scenario where a child enters the door path during a closing cycle initiated by an adult who doesn't see the child in Keedysville.

What the Hold-Button Method Actually Removes From the Safety System in Keedysville, MD

Holding the wall button to close the door when the sensor is faulty switches the opener to a supervised manual close mode in Keedysville. In this mode, the automatic beam-interruption reversal is not active in Keedysville, MD. If the beam is interrupted during the close cycle because a child has entered the door path, the door does not reverse automatically in Keedysville. Visual observation and human reaction time are not adequate substitutes for the automatic beam-interruption reversal in Keedysville, MD.

Sensors are required to be installed no higher than six inches from the floor to ensure they can detect a small child or pet in the door's path in Keedysville. Raising them significantly higher to avoid a low bumper would compromise this safety function and isn't something EZ Open recommends or performs in Keedysville, MD. If a low-clearance vehicle is repeatedly triggering a reversal, the better solution is adjusting how the vehicle is parked relative to the sensor beam rather than relocating the sensors in Keedysville.
A sensor problem typically causes the door to reverse mid-close, since it's detecting an interrupted beam during the closing cycle in Keedysville. A limit switch problem typically causes the door to stop short of the floor, or to fail to fully open, without necessarily reversing, since it's related to where the opener registers the door's travel boundaries in Keedysville, MD. EZ Open distinguishes between the two through the specific symptom pattern, where the door stops versus whether it reverses in Keedysville.
